I have a five wire throttle ( green, black,red, blue and yellow) and have three wires (green, black, red) coming out of the controller. Pictures of controller attached

The throttle has a key and voltage display. I have tried to hook up and it will light up and that is it. Does anyone know where to go from here?

The blue and yellow is just the key switch. You can verify this with a Multimeter.

Some controlllers have a power on wire which needs to be connected to the battery positive (usually a thin red wire)

This should be connected to one side of the key switch and the battery positive to the other, that way when you turn the key it connects the red wire and powers the controller on
